Why Are Hurricane Impact Windows Essential in Boca Raton? Hurricane impact windows are designed to withstand the high winds and flying debris associated with severe storms. Regular windows can easily shatter during a hurricane, leading to significant damage to your home and personal property. Impact windows are constructed with reinforced glass and frames, offering a higher level of protection.

Wind Mitigation Credits and Insurance Savings Florida insurers apply wind mitigation credits when opening protection is documented. After installation, a licensed inspector completes the OIR-B1-1802 Uniform Mitigation Verification Inspection Form, which records opening protection level, roof deck attachment, and roof-to-wall connection. Properties where all openings use NOA-approved impact windows usually reach the highest opening protection classification, and STS provides the product approval documentation carriers request.

What Are Impact Windows and How Do They Work? Impact windows are constructed from laminated glass, designed to absorb and dissipate energy from strong impacts. The unique composition involves a layer of polyvinyl butyral (PVB) sandwiched between two layers of glass, making it much more resilient than standard windows. When debris strikes, the glass may crack, but it typically remains intact, thanks to the PVB layer, which keeps the shards from scattering.

Cost of Impact Windows in Boca Raton: What to Expect The cost of impact windows in Boca Raton can vary widely based on factors such as size, brand, and installation complexity. On average, homeowners can expect to pay between $800 to $1,500 per window, including installation. Larger or custom-designed windows can command even higher prices.
